Watch in High Quality! Watch the morning routine of starting the Pacific Southwest Railway Museum's GP9. The Museum is located in Campo, California; about a hour's drive from San Diego. The locomotive is a former Cotton Belt GP9 built in 1959. The locomotive was repainted into Southern Pacific Black Widow Colors. The locomotive, SP 3873, is used to pull the museum's weekend trips from the historic Campo depot to the Mexican Border Tunnel at division.

This Video Shows the full startup sequence of an EMD GP9 locomotive. SP 3873 is a high hood, 1st generation diesel. It has a two-stroke 1750 Horsepower EMD 567C non turbo charged prime mover, a shaft driven air compressor, dynamic braking, and Multiple Unit capability.
First Jack, the engineer, connects the battery. Then, he throws some switches in the cab to get the necessary systems required to start the locomotive running. Then, he goes outside to open the Cylinder cocks on each of the 16 cylinders. This is necessary to perform the blowdown. Next, he cleans out the 4 carbon traps. The carbon traps collect carbon from the exhaust. Jack also explains why oil sometimes collects in the carbon traps. It is very important to empty the carbon traps before each day's run in order to prevent a fire. As you can see in the video, the carbon traps are doing their job and are fully emptied before the locomotive is started. Jack also checks the water level plus the engine, governor, and air compressor oil levels. Then, while holding the layshaft in the off position, he flips the starter switch to turn the engine over a few times to blow down the engine. The open cylinder cocks allow any moisture or other contaminants that may have accumulated in the cylinders to blow out. This is necessary since they may damage the engine while it is running. Jack then closes the cylinder cocks. The locomotive is now ready to be started. First, the starter is turned to the left to prime the engine for about 30 seconds. Then, while pushing the layshaft in to increase the engine speed, the starter is turned to the right. The engine then rumbles to life. Jack shows the water level dropping after the engine starts. Then, he opens the valve lid to allow you to see the valves opening and closing on each cylinder.

htc6600.... 567 U (cast, top deck) & V (fabricated & welded deck) pretty well non-existent, and too many "issues" with those two anyway. The A & B models were an improvement - somwhat, but parts are getting scarce. The 567 AC & BC were greatly improved with the water, liner & con rod issues and so are much more in demand and parts for the AC & BC engines are still "on the books" even from EMD themselves (owned by Cat since Dec. 2010). The most desirable 567 engines are the 567 C (first with the round hand hole covers and removal of the water deck feature, new style liners, etc.) and the D1 as far as roots blown engines and the D2, 3 & 3A axial flow turbocharged engines.... parts are still readily available in 2020 and not too hard to obtain. Many roads (esp. Short lines) with locomotives powered with any of the D2, 3 & 3A (turbocharged - all 16 cyl.) and most certainly "tourist" roads and museums with very light usage, normally will de-rate them back down to D1 or C specs by naturally aspirating them with roots blowers instead. Typical (currently) "basic" rebuild of the turbo is $15 to 18,000 dollars and upwards of $40,000 dollars for a catastrophic turbo failure, plus the cost of downtime, install time and any damage done internally, caused by the turbo failure and most shortlines, museum and tourist lines cannot afford that kind of maintenance & repair costs. Another reason for the potential future longevity of the 567C, & D series is that the 645 series power assemblies can be (and are, during upgrades) adapted to the 567C & D1, 2, 3 & D3A as long as the cam counterweights are changed to offset the heavier weight of the series 645 piston and rod assembly.

This engine design ... 567 and 656E/645F and 710G all employ hydraulic "lash adjusters" from the start. These would not be used in automobile engines for several more decades. There are three rockers per cylinder, all of which have roller cam followers. The outer pair of rockers operate the four exhaust valves through spring-loaded "bridges". The inner rocker operates the "unit injector". Intake timing is fixed at about 45º BBDC to about 45º ABDC. Injection is fixed at 4º BTDC.
